Just one team in Staines ..........
Views: 3896
This was part of the promise of the new venture for Staines and Lammas FC. The silence about next season if we achieve promotion has been deafening. Will we have facilities for the team to go up to the next level, or are we promised the same as this season. We also have fixture problems and are going to play matches out of the borough at Abbey Rangers. They are a good side with good facilities. If I wished to travel to Addlestone I could do so regularly. I could also choose to go the Chertsey, Met Police, Hampton etc. I chose to go with the one team in Staines. Were inquiries made to play the game at Ashford, Ogham, Bedfont Sports, or, dare I say, Wheatsheaf Park and a one off game. Fans deserve to know and to understand the future of the new venture.

Wakes, I think that to truly understand the lease situation of Wheatsheaf Park you would need to spend a fortune on legal fees. I think the proceeds of sale of the Manchester City first team squad would not be enough. I am not a lawye, just an accountant (one of my auditing lecturers once commented the only accountant I would make would be a turf accountant!). I just want to watch football. In precise, from hearsay, there is a clause to say that the sale agreement of Wheatsheaf Park stated their use for football in perpetuity. There is a lease between the owners and STFC Limited which was due for review imminently. The Thames Club took STFC Limited to court for non-payment of sums due. STFC Limited never showed. The judgement was that a receiver be appoi9nted to liquidate STFC Limited. This is currently in operation. STFC Limited will be properly liquidated in the near future. That would mean there is no existing lease. My point is not that a new lease be renegotiated ( that would be lovely) but that if we need to find an alternative venue for a one off home game, should that be in the borough - or in Addleston, or Wembley.
